Jahura Akter Reshma (born {{birth date|1998|07|11|df=y}}) is a Bangladeshi female weightlifter, competing in the 48 kg category and representing Bangladesh at international competitions.
She participated at the 2014 Asian Games in the 48 kg event and at the 2014 Summer Youth Olympics in the Girls' 48 kg event.{{cite web|title=Weightlifting at the 2nd Youth Olympic Games - Jahura Akter Reshma|url=http://www.iwf.net/results/results-by-events/?event=295 |publisher=iwf.net|accessdate=23 June 2016}}
